Solution for -x+4=2(x-3) equation:



-x+4=2(x-3)
We move all terms to the left:
-x+4-(2(x-3))=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-1x-(2(x-3))+4=0
We calculate terms in parentheses: -(2(x-3)), so:
2(x-3)
We multiply parentheses
2x-6
Back to the equation:
-(2x-6)
We get rid of parentheses
-1x-2x+6+4=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-3x+10=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
-3x=-10
x=-10/-3
x=3+1/3
